From recent posts here on the Disboards, it appears they have lowered the refill cost since we last cruised. My experience was the bucket cost $7.50 to purchase the first time and $3.50 to refill. The cost to refill the bucket was the same as the cost of a single order of popcorn, but the bucket held more popcorn. It seems the cost to refill is now under $2.

Last week on Magic, we used the bucket we bought in December on the Wonder. Refill with tax is 1.73. The bucket was 8 something I think. I thought it was a good value since we like popcorn at shows.
 
It was a green lid one last week on the Dream. We bought the Star Wars ship type one. It was $1.50 for refills and they did not put the popcorn in the ship just gave us the refill in a red box
